Transaction 1a633c58026cf738f1f5ebbd00a7e6f004fa1d847054ba7f70e29687e4058a8e
1 Input
2 Outputs
- 1a633c58026cf738f1f5ebbd00a7e6f004fa1d847054ba7f70e29687e4058a8e:0
- 1a633c58026cf738f1f5ebbd00a7e6f004fa1d847054ba7f70e29687e4058a8e:1
value 4925364
address 3FfuN3Uf87boKSNfE8NiqvWm5cFj8EBhf6
value 2342561
address 17rbDpTZ3968XK1aD3cZ6AHkkHrdKAMtqY